#1c2272 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1c2272 is composed of 11% red, 13.3%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.4%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 235.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.6% and a lightness of 27.8%. #1c2272 color hex could be obtained by blending #3844e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#1c2272

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f3f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c2272

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#42434c is the less saturated color, while #010b8d is the most saturated one.
